Features To Look For In Best Shoe Polishes
Before deciding which is the best shoe polish for you, make sure you check out these key features to get a better idea of what you should always look for.
Color - Whether you use shoe paint or shoe polish, you need to make sure that the color of the product matches the color of your shoes.
It may sound obvious if you are experienced with using shoe polish. However, if you order without first considering the color of the polish, you could be in for a terrible time. You are unlikely to ever find an exact match for the color of your shoes. This is okay, though, as you should still aim to match the color as close as you can to accentuate the existing color and make it more dynamic, restoring it as close as you can to how the shoes looked when brand new.
With this in mind, tan shoe polish is perfect for tan shoes. Likewise, the black polish is suitable for black shoes only, red shoe polish for red leather, and so on. Most products come with a wide variety of color options so you can be sure you select the closest match for your shoes. As most leather dress shoes are black or brown, you can also purchase double packs that provide both options, which also ensures excellent value.
For other materials or other colors, it’s always best to check t5he care instructions to make sure they are suitable for use with shoe polish.
Ingredients - To the layman, shoe polish ingredients may not seem that important, but if you know a lot about shoe polish and proper shoe care, whether leather shoes or not, then you will understand why it is worth considering.
Ideally, you want all-natural ingredients that won’t affect the material. These ingredients can be anything from beeswax to pine resin, among a plethora of other options. Some ingredients are more beneficial for treating, waterproofing, and nourishing leather, so if you have specific qualities in mind, it’s always worth looking out for these.
The right ingredients will also prevent the material from drying out and cracking, which can also accelerate deterioration. They keep it close to the natural state, which ensures longevity and durability. As we all know how pricey some leather shoes can be, this is a critical thing to consider.
Application - Depending on the shoe material, you are likely to need to apply it in unique ways. Typically, leather shoes require a leather cleaning brush, which provides sufficient scrub without scratching or damaging the leather. You can also combine this with an old t-shirt or cleaning cloth to add the shiny finish you want.
Horsehair brushes are the best option for leather, but if you don’t have a dedicated leather cleaning brush handy, you can always use a cleaning cloth.
As for other materials, such as canvas, you can use a cloth with polish that matches the color of the shoes to ensure the best and shiniest clean. Most often, you will clean white sneakers, such as Converse or Vans.
Some polish brands will come with an applicator brush included in the package, but if not, there are alternatives available.
Shoe Polish FAQ
Q: Does shoe polish soften leather?
A: Shoe polish is an excellent way to soften leather shoes, nourish them, and make them easier to wear. This is useful for brand new leather shoes, which are not yet flexible enough to be comfortable for all-day wear.
The more you wear them, the softer the leather becomes, making them more comfortable. Some people may prefer to achieve this softness the natural way. However, if you are desperate to wear these shoes but cannot cope with how hard and stiff the leather is, choosing the right softening shoe polish will be the best way to go.
There are other ways to soften the leather, but as you will already have shoe polish, this is the best place to start.
Q: Is shoe polish vegan?
A: It's difficult to discern which shoe polish brands are cruelty-free and vegan friendly and which are not. We know that Kiwi prides itself on being a vegan polish, but this is not necessarily the case for everything, and it can often depend on your definition of what is acceptable as a vegan product.’
For example, as some products use beeswax in the polish formula, you could argue that this is not vegan. However, this can also depend on how the beeswax is sourced. That being said, if you are at all concerned about the nature of the development, then you can get in touch directly with the manufacturer for more information.
Q: Does polishing shoes waterproof them?
A: Polishing shoes will, sometimes, provide a slight and temporary waterproofing element. Leather is one of the most waterproof materials as it is, so you shouldn’t need to worry too much about wet socks and feet even without shoe polish.
Despite this, vegan-friendly faux leather, canvas, and other materials are not always as waterproof as you might want them to be. Here, it’s useful to know whether the shoe polish you use will provide the adequate waterproofing you need to handle wet days and nights wherever you are.
For the most efficient waterproofing elements, beeswax and pine resin are two of the primary ingredients which are effective for sufficiently waterproofing leather shoes. Anything else and you will only get minor waterproofing success. Beeswax and pine resin also provide the extra shine you need, which ensures that your shoes will be both protected and look good whatever the occasion.
Q: Can you leave shoe polish on overnight?
A: Yes, you can. In fact, most brands recommend that you leave it on overnight. This is useful if you do not have the time to spend too long polishing your shoes or are in no particular rush to make them look as good as new.
Experts recommend that the longer you keep the polish on, the better the result will be. Therefore, leaving polish on your shoes overnight will be more beneficial compared to leaving them for just 20 minutes. This is because the extended time allows the natural ingredients to work into the leather and nourish it more effectively.
If you are consistent with your shoe polish, you may not need to leave it on for so long. However, if you are polishing your shoes for the first time to prepare for a big event, such as a wedding or interview, then leaving it on overnight will provide the best results.
